打印

求教:LEVEL加密的F051如何擦除重新写入?

[复制链接]
2014|5
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
sszxxm|  楼主 | 2012-11-17 10:28 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
因为没仔细了解加密类型,手一抖就在给客户的样板上做了LEVEL2加密,现在样板需要改程序,才发现已经无法擦除和写入了。
芯片型号:STM32F051K6,QFN33封装
编程调试接口:SWD
编程软件:STVP,ST网站刚下载的最新版本3.2.7

图片稍后上传,刚刚上传说是无效的图片文件。

先行谢过!
沙发
airwill| | 2012-11-17 13:36 | 只看该作者
做了LEVEL2加密, 是可以擦除的.
可以用 ISP 擦除.
也可以用 JTAG. 引脚设定到 ISP 模式下, 擦除.

使用特权

评论回复
板凳
sszxxm|  楼主 | 2012-11-17 17:49 | 只看该作者
谢谢楼上的回复:
1)ISP软件不支持串口下载;
2)芯片封装太小,实际使用的IO口没几个,大部分没有引出了,所以想接JTAG口没戏了。

现在已经把芯片用热风枪吹下来了,明天白天换芯片,以后加倍小心了。

使用特权

评论回复
地板
airwill| | 2012-11-19 10:37 | 只看该作者
楼主的经验教训, 值得大家参考.
以后在设计硬件前, 要尽量考虑到编程调试等方面的灵活性性.

使用特权

评论回复
5
IJK| | 2012-11-19 10:53 | 只看该作者
印象里STM32F0 进行LEVEL2加密后,无法再通过JTAG口进行操作,LS试过还能擦除吗?

使用特权

评论回复
6
sszxxm|  楼主 | 2012-11-20 17:37 | 只看该作者
楼主的经验教训, 值得大家参考.
以后在设计硬件前, 要尽量考虑到编程调试等方面的灵活性性.
airwill 发表于 2012-11-19 10:37


不是没考虑,是板子面积要求太高,根本放不下你说的那些接口的位置。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

25

主题

596

帖子

2

粉丝